MNAE programme

The programme "A New Beginning in Technical Schools" (M.N.A.E.) was piloted in the school year 2017-18 in 9 Vocational High Schools, utilizing experiences and practices already applied by the educational community in school units and, more specifically, in some Vocational High Schools. In other words, it is a programme born of the educational community of Vocational Education itself, which is why a large part of its spread process is based on the transmission of the experience of the teachers themselves.

Our school participates in that
programme from 2018-19 school year. It is co-financed by the NSRF and has secured funding for 4 years and includes the following actions:

    Alternative remedial teaching for the first grade students of our school in Greek Language and Mathematics, co-taught by two teachers simultaneously in the classroom and within the school schedule, to enhance language and numerical literacy.
    Staffing of Technical Schools with psychologists, aiming at the psychosocial support of students, but also in general the educational process, as well as to organize the networking of schools with supportive structures of psychosocial health of the area.
    Activation of the institution of "Professor Counselor", which will contribute to better communication between students, but also in general to the improvement of the climate in the school community.
    Creation of "Action Plans", funded, that promote innovation and creativity in schools and promote science, technology and culture.
    Equip Technical Schools with teleconferencing infrastructure, to enable communication and collaboration between schools in joint actions.
    Networking of schools through common communication platforms that allow communication between schools, but also with support structures in their area.
